The Role of Safety Features in Car Insurance Estimates by Model

Car insurance estimates can differ significantly based on your car’s model, largely due to the various safety features each model offers. These features are essential in determining insurance costs, as they help reduce the risk of accidents and injuries. Understanding how these features impact your car insurance estimate by model can guide you in making smarter vehicle choices.

Safety features act like superheroes for your car, protecting you and your passengers during accidents. They also play a vital role in lowering your car insurance estimate by model. Insurers favor cars with advanced safety features because they minimize the likelihood of accidents.

Key Safety Features That Impact Insurance Costs

  • Airbags: Provide cushioning during crashes, reducing injury risk and potentially lowering insurance costs.
  • Anti-lock Brakes: Prevent skidding and help maintain control, often leading to insurance discounts.
  • Electronic Stability Control: Prevents spinning out in slippery conditions, frequently rewarded with lower rates by insurers.

Why Insurers Care About Safety Features

Insurance companies prioritize safety features to reduce accident claim costs. Cars less prone to accidents or injuries often receive better insurance rates. Are Electric Cars Cheaper to Insure? Exploring Estimates by Model

When it comes to buying a car, many people wonder about the cost of insurance. The car insurance estimate by model is crucial because it helps you understand how much you might pay each month. Electric cars are becoming more popular, but are they cheaper to insure? Let’s find out!

Electric cars often have higher repair costs due to their advanced technology, which can affect insurance rates. However, they also have fewer moving parts, which might mean fewer breakdowns. So, the insurance cost can vary depending on the model.

FAQ

  • Does the car model affect insurance rates?
    Yes, models with higher repair costs, theft rates, or powerful engines typically have higher premiums.

  • Which car models are the cheapest to insure?
    Sedans, minivans, and vehicles with high safety ratings usually have lower insurance costs.

  • How do insurers estimate rates based on the model?
    They consider factors like safety features, crash-test ratings, cost of parts, and historical claim data.

  • Do sports cars have higher insurance premiums?
    Yes, due to their speed potential and higher likelihood of being involved in accidents or theft.

  • Can I compare insurance estimates for different models online?
    Yes, many insurance websites offer tools to compare estimated premiums based on make and model.
